In "Miguel's Brave Knight: Young Cervantes and His Dream of Don Quixote," the story follows a young Miguel de Cervantes, who dreams of becoming a great writer and creating heroic tales. Set in the backdrop of 16th-century Spain, Miguel faces challenges and hardships that inspire his imagination. As he navigates his youthful adventures, he draws upon his love for chivalry and the fantastical, ultimately leading him to envision his most famous character, Don Quixote. This beautifully illustrated tale captures the essence of creativity, courage, and the power of dreams, setting the stage for Cervantes' literary legacy. Margarita Engle is a Cuban American poet, novelist, and journalist whose work has been published in many countries. She is the author of young adult nonfiction books and novels in verse, including The Surrender Tree , a Newbery Honor Book; The Poet Slave of Cuba ; The Firefly Letters ; and Tropical Secrets . She lives in northern California.
